1971 Chevrolet Corvette vs. 2009 Dodge Nitro
To start off, 2009 Dodge Nitro is newer by 38 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1971 Chevrolet Corvette.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1971 Chevrolet Corvette would be higher. At 5,737 cc (8 cylinders), 1971 Chevrolet Corvette is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1971 Chevrolet Corvette (330 HP) has 155 more horse power than 2009 Dodge Nitro. (175 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1971 Chevrolet Corvette should accelerate faster than 2009 Dodge Nitro.
Because 2009 Dodge Nitro is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1971 Chevrolet Corvette.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Dodge Nitro will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
